Cops: "Bachelor" Gal Fought Squad Car, Lost

The season six winner of "The Bachelor" continued her losing streak with law enforcement this weekend -- after cops say she unleashed a drunken, unprovoked attack on an innocent cop car.

Mary Delgado -- who was arrested last year for allegedly punching her fiance, "Bachelor" Byron Velvick -- was busted again on Saturday night for public intoxication, resisting arrest and disorderly conduct at Lorina's Cantina in Del Rio, Texas.

We're told the Cantina called the cops because Delgado refused to leave the bar, saying it was her "constitutional right" to stay as long as she wanted.

Cops told us Mary became "loud and belligerent" while being transported to jail, and kicked the radio inside the squad car (which didn't have the usual backseat perp cage).

Delgado was released from the Val Verde County Correctional Facility after Mr. Bachelor posted her bond. Punch me once, shame on me...

"Biggest Loser" Accused of Screwing Chubb-y

A guy who won $100K on "The Biggest Loser" is facing some heavy jail time for allegedly trying to bilk an insurance company out of $63,000.

Season one loser David Fioravanti just was indicted by a Massachusetts grand jury on seven counts of insurance fraud -- he allegedly tried to insure $63K worth of jewels that he already had reported as stolen a year before, reports the Boston Globe. And he tried to perpetrate this scheme not once, but twice, says the DA.

And get this -- one of the allegedly victimized insurance companies was named ... Chubb Insurance!!!

Big Bro Walks Over Memphis

"Big Brother" is in a little doo doo this AM.

In the first episode of BB10, Memphis won a sweet 1969 Camaro in a car-pulling contest (don't ask). Small problem -- "Big Brother" couldn't give the car away because the show didn't own it. We're told someone else actually held the title. In fact, the car had already been returned to the owner almost immediately after the contest.

Memphis the Mixologist was none the wiser because no one told him about the snag while he was inside the house. But on Tuesday, Memphis gained his freedom, losing to Dan, and learned the car he had come to treasure wasn't really his. Another problem -- the car has been repainted since it was on the show.

We're told producers are now scrambling to buy the car from the real owner. Sources say the real owner will turn the keys over for $24,000. A '69 Camaro online sell for anywhere between 7 and as much as 80 grand. Fact is, Big Bro doesn't have a lot of bargaining power, so they are more SOL than HOH.

We made several calls to "Big Brother" -- so far, no comment.

Clubber: "Bad Girl" Popped Off, Broke My Face

The craziest, most violent and baddest "Bad Girl's Club" member of them all is under serious fire for doing what she does best -- poppin' off and puttin' some fool on his ass!
Tanisha Thomas: Click to view!
Tanisha Thomas is being sued by a guy who claims she bashed him in the face with a beer mug during an eye-bangin' smackdown at a Hollywood nightclub back in November. According to the lawsuit, filed today in L.A. County Superior Court, Kenneth Corrales claims he was just hangin' out when Thomas acted "in a manner not conducive to normal society" and caused a "deep laceration" to his forehead with a beer mug.

The entire brawl was caught on tape by the "Bad Girls Cub" camera crew, promoted, and featured in an episode -- in which a medic can be seen pressing a bandage against the guy's forehead. After the fight, Thomas was arrested, booked and locked up for a few days.

Corrales is suing Thomas and Bunim-Murray, the company that produces the show, for an unspecified amount of cash. Calls to their reps have not yet been returned.

"Top Chef" Villain Cooked for DUI

Knives out: The most-hated bad boy in the history of reality cooking shows just spent some time in the cooler for allegedly consuming a little too much of the good stuff.

Marcel Vigneron -- the runner-up in "Top Chef" season two -- was pinched early Saturday morning on suspicion of DUI off the PCH in Laguna Beach. Marcel was initially stopped for speeding, but after showing signs of intoxication he was given a blood test and was taken into custody. Bail was set at $2,500.

Man loves his craft: Even after spending a night in the slammer, he went straight to a cooking demo in O.C. No, the popo didn't Ginsu his license -- he still can drive despite the DUI.

"Biggest Loser" Winner -- Giant Pain in the Neck

With a name like Matt Hoover, you'd expect that the "Biggest Loser" champ would suck at personal training. Well, if you believe a new neck-breaking lawsuit, he's an even bigger loser than you thought.
Read the docs
Clarissa Sanford claims she hired Hoover in 2006 to tone her ass up at Vision Quest Sports and Fitness in King County, Washington. She says Hoover not only was late and careless, but also, instead of spotting her, he walked away while she was bench pressing 40 pounds of weight. Sandford says by the time he returned the weight crashed down on her neck.

As a result, Sanford says she suffered "serious neck injuries which ultimately required a five-level fusion surgery from the C3 through C7 levels of her cervical spine."

She's suing Hoover and VQS for unspecified damages.

Hoover and club couldn't immediately be reached for comment.
